Commissioning

Fig 8 - 

NT 1500-XT Power Shower

The valve allows the maximum showering temperature to be set at a safe level, 

preventing accidental scalding.  This setting should be made during commissioning

and will require that the hot water cylinder is at its normal operating temperature.

IMPORTANT:

The handset must be in the spray mode.  

We recommend the reading of User Instructions before proceeding further.  This

will familiarise you with the operation of the shower.

Temperature Adjustment

Procedure:

Turn the brass mixer valve spindle fully clockwise, and then anti-clockwise until the

black line on the spindle is aligned with the groove on the mixer body, and fit the

control knob in the fully cold position. Check that it is correctly fitted by turning fully

clockwise to the stop, pull the knob off and check that the black line and groove are

aligned. Adjust if necessary. This sets the shower temperature to 38-40ºC, with the

control knob pointing to “12 o’clock”, if the hot water is at the recommended 60ºC.

Commissioning

1) Connect the shower hose – without the handset – to the outlet from the unit.

2) Turn on the hot and cold water isolating valves, and the electricity-isolating

switch, and place the open end of the shower hose in the shower tray or bath.

3) Set the temperature control knob to cold, fully clockwise, and press the 

“Stop/Start” button.

4) Cold water will flow from the hose, and this should be allowed to continue for 2

minutes, after which time the control knob may be turned to the “12 o’clock” position.

Allow the water to run for a few minutes to stabilise the hot water flow, and then

check that the water is at a comfortable showering temperature.

5) If it is too hot or too cold, turn off the electricity-isolating switch, pull off the

control knob,and adjust the brass spindle anti-clockwise to increase the temperature

- clockwise to decrease. Replace the knob in the “12 o’clock” position, switch the

electricity on, and check the water temperature. Readjust as necessary until a

satisfactory temperature is achieved.

6) Pass the shower hose through the hole in the soap dish and, using the rubber sealing

washer supplied, fit the showerhead to the hose and place the showerhead in the

handset holder.

7) Press the Stop/Start button. Water flows from the shower head under the gravity

pressure from the storage tank. 

Press the Shower Boost button and the 

pump starts, boosting the shower pressure.
